Subject: Insurance renewal – heads up

Team, quick note for branch managers before the exec call. Our cover with Penhallow Mutual renews next month; premiums are up about 8%, mostly due to the warehouse claims last year. We're pushing back on the liability tier and may switch brokers. Don't commit to any site works that affect coverage until this settles. Sensitive detail appended below.

board note of yadup-fajef: Druiusox Holdings is in early talks to buy Norwynek Systems for about $186.0 million. The Kaseth launch date is June 24, and nothing goes to the press before then. Legal wants the Quenethek Group term sheet withdrawn before November 27.

## Deployment

As discussed at the weekly sync, the Quillgate internal gateway now enforces per-client rate limits at the edge pods rather than in each service. Rollout is complete in staging; production follows Thursday. Teams should confirm their client IDs are registered before then, since unregistered callers fall into the strict default bucket. The limiter pods start with the following configuration values.

config for kafof-bawef:
holath:
  log_level: debug
  metrics_host: metrics.holath.qorvelsys.internal
  pin: 2191
  pool_size: 32

**TICKET: Signature verification failure — VaultSpin rotation utility**

The nightly VaultSpin run on the Drossel cluster failed at the verify step: the rotated bundle's detached signature does not match the trusted signer set. Likely cause is last week's migration of the build host to the Pellick image, which dropped the pinned signer config. Rotation is paused until verification passes; no secrets were distributed. To restore verification, re-pin the trusted signer entry with the key below.

rollout seal: bky4_x7Gc

Welcome to the BranchReaper plugin ecosystem! BranchReaper is our stale-branch cleanup bot — it sweeps repos nightly and flags anything untouched for 90 days. Your plugin hooks into the pre-delete phase, so you can veto deletions or archive refs first. Register your plugin in the Tollgate dev portal before testing against staging. If the bot locks you out of its sandbox, use the recovery passphrase below.

recovery phrase for bawep-kawef: oliath-casdor